
Warm, fragrant, and deeply comforting, this spiced apple compote is the kind of simple recipe that makes your whole kitchen smell incredible. Chunks of fresh apple are simmered down with maple syrup, fresh ginger, cinnamon, turmeric, and cardamom until they're meltingly tender and coated in a light, glossy syrup. A squeeze of lemon juice keeps everything bright and balanced, cutting through the warmth of the spices beautifully. The whole thing comes together in a single saucepan with no fuss โ just stir, simmer, and decide how chunky or smooth you want it. It's naturally free from any animal proteins, relying entirely on fruit, spice, and a touch of sweetness to deliver serious flavor. Spoon it over oatmeal, yogurt, or pancakes, or serve it alongside roasted pork or a cheese board for something a little more unexpected. Combine the apple chunks, maple syrup, ginger, cinnamon, turmeric, cardamom, lemon juice, water, and salt in a medium saucepan. Stir to coat the apples evenly.
Set the saucepan over medium heat and bring to a gentle simmer, stirring occasionally, until the liquid begins to bubble around the edges, about 3โ4 minutes.
